Adrian walked into the cabin, taking a look around. He noticed how messy it was and full of all sorts of different items and personalities. Great, he thought, I have to share the cabin with a lot of other kids. Of course, he didn't expect to have his own cabin, but maybe one without about a thousand kids would be nice. He sighed. Today wasn't a good day for him. He just figured out he was a demi-god, and there were all these gods and goddesses ruling the world basically.
Looking around for Night, his black and white Border Collie, Adrian spotted him on top of an empty bunk. Raising his eyebrows, he walks towards the bunk, sitting down. He didn't have any belongings, besides his dog, and his newly received sword, Nightmare. Crossing his legs on the bed, he lay down, deciding it would be a good time for a nap. He didn't know how long ago he slept on a bed this comfortable, and he loved it. Within a few seconds, he was drifting off to sleep and snoring lightly.
